Quick Summary

The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), specifically the VA Healthcare System, Network Contracting Office 1, Regional Procurement Office East, has issued a Notice of Intent to Sole Source for the design and fabrication of an Advanced Blast Simulator. The VA intends to negotiate a contract with Stumptown Research and Development, LLC (Black Mountain, NC) as the sole responsible source. This system is required for testing biomedical targets at the White River Junction Veterans Affairs Medical Center. Responses demonstrating clear and convincing evidence that competition would be advantageous to the Government are due by April 10, 2026, at 3:30 PM EST.

Scope of Work

The requirement is for the design and fabrication of an Advanced Blast Simulator with a 24in x 24in internal cross section. Key components include a dual mode driver, an expanding transition section, a test section with two observation ports and multiple sensor locations, and an end wave eliminator. The system must also include one test specimen holder, a data acquisition computer, a pitot-static probe, and three piezoresistive wall-mounted pressure sensors. Installation and operational training are mandatory. The service location is the White River Junction Veterans Affairs Medical Center, VT.
